Understanding the Basics of AI in Web Development

Before diving into the implementation, it’s crucial to understand what AI entails in the context of web development. AI refers to the simulation of human intelligence in machines that are programmed to think like humans and mimic their actions. In web development, AI can be used to enhance user experience, automate tasks, and provide personalized content.

Key Components of AI in Websites

  1. Machine Learning (ML): ML algorithms enable websites to learn from data and improve over time without being explicitly programmed. This can be used for recommendation systems, predictive analytics, and more.
  2. Natural Language Processing (NLP): NLP allows websites to understand and respond to human language, enabling features like chatbots and voice search.
  3. Computer Vision: This involves the ability of a website to interpret and understand visual information, such as image recognition and video analysis.
  4. Speech Recognition: This technology allows websites to convert spoken language into text, facilitating voice commands and interactions.

Steps to Implement AI in a Website

1. Define the Purpose and Scope

The first step in implementing AI on a website is to clearly define the purpose and scope of the AI integration. Ask yourself:

  • What problem are you trying to solve?
  • How will AI enhance the user experience?
  • What are the specific goals you want to achieve?

2. Choose the Right AI Tools and Frameworks

There are numerous AI tools and frameworks available that can be integrated into a website. Some popular options include:

  • TensorFlow: An open-source machine learning framework developed by Google.
  • PyTorch: A deep learning framework that provides flexibility and speed.
  • IBM Watson: A suite of AI services that can be integrated into web applications.
  • Microsoft Azure AI: A collection of AI services and tools offered by Microsoft.

3. Data Collection and Preparation

AI systems rely heavily on data. To implement AI effectively, you need to collect and prepare relevant data. This involves:

  • Data Collection: Gather data from various sources, such as user interactions, social media, and sensors.
  • Data Cleaning: Remove any irrelevant or duplicate data to ensure the quality of your dataset.
  • Data Labeling: Label the data to help the AI system understand and learn from it.

4. Model Training and Testing

Once the data is prepared, the next step is to train the AI model. This involves:

  • Model Selection: Choose the appropriate machine learning model based on your goals.
  • Training: Use the prepared data to train the model. This process involves feeding the data into the model and allowing it to learn patterns and make predictions.
  • Testing: Evaluate the model’s performance using a separate dataset to ensure it works as expected.

5. Integration with the Website

After the model is trained and tested, it needs to be integrated into the website. This can be done through APIs or by embedding the model directly into the website’s code. Key considerations include:

  • API Integration: Use APIs to connect the AI model with the website. This allows the website to send data to the model and receive predictions or responses.
  • User Interface (UI) Design: Ensure that the AI features are seamlessly integrated into the website’s UI. This includes designing intuitive interfaces for chatbots, recommendation systems, and other AI-driven features.

6. Continuous Monitoring and Improvement

AI systems are not static; they require continuous monitoring and improvement. This involves:

  • Performance Monitoring: Regularly check the performance of the AI model to ensure it is functioning correctly.
  • Feedback Loop: Collect user feedback to identify areas for improvement.
  • Model Retraining: Periodically retrain the model with new data to keep it up-to-date and accurate.

Practical Applications of AI in Websites

1. Personalized User Experience

AI can be used to create personalized experiences for website visitors. For example, e-commerce websites can use AI to recommend products based on a user’s browsing history and preferences. This not only enhances the user experience but also increases the likelihood of conversions.

2. Chatbots and Virtual Assistants

Chatbots powered by AI can handle customer inquiries, provide support, and even assist with transactions. These virtual assistants can operate 24/7, providing instant responses and improving customer satisfaction.

3. Predictive Analytics

AI can analyze user behavior and predict future actions. For instance, a news website can use AI to predict which articles a user is likely to read next, thereby increasing engagement and time spent on the site.

4. Content Generation

AI can be used to generate content, such as product descriptions, blog posts, and even news articles. This can save time and resources while ensuring that the content is relevant and engaging.

5. Image and Video Recognition

Websites can use AI to analyze images and videos, enabling features like automatic tagging, content moderation, and even facial recognition. This can be particularly useful for social media platforms and e-commerce sites.

6. Voice Search and Commands

With the rise of voice-activated devices, integrating voice search and commands into websites has become increasingly important. AI-powered voice recognition can enhance accessibility and provide a more intuitive user experience.

Challenges and Considerations

While the benefits of AI in web development are numerous, there are also challenges and considerations to keep in mind:

1. Data Privacy and Security

AI systems rely on data, and with data comes the responsibility of ensuring privacy and security. It’s essential to implement robust data protection measures and comply with regulations like GDPR.

2. Ethical Considerations

AI can sometimes lead to ethical dilemmas, such as bias in algorithms or the potential for misuse. It’s crucial to address these issues and ensure that AI is used responsibly.

3. Technical Complexity

Implementing AI on a website can be technically complex, requiring specialized knowledge and skills. It’s important to have a team with the necessary expertise or to partner with AI specialists.

4. Cost

AI implementation can be costly, especially when it comes to data collection, model training, and infrastructure. It’s important to weigh the costs against the potential benefits.
